Time for some spoilers on surprise Royal Rumble entrants. If you don't want to have some potential surprises ruined, check out one of our other fine articles. If you like spoilers, read away.

The Royal Rumble is always a fun show for fans, partly due to the surprise factor surrounding the show. First, there's the mystery of who will win the event and land themselves a world championship match at WrestleMania. Second, there's the surprise of Superstars from the past returning, new Superstars debuting in the event, and absent Superstars (often absent due to injury).

Three Rumored Rumble Surprises

With The Royal Rumble less than three weeks away, there are already many predictions on who will win the Men and Women's matches. However, what about surprise entrants? Here are three names to consider.

Naomi: Rumors have been heating up that Naomi (currently working in TNA Wrestling as its Knockouts Champion Trinity) is returning to the WWE once her TNA contract expires. A recent report from PWInsider suggests Naomi's TNA deal could be up sometime in January:

Trinity Update: One source has since contacted PWInsider.com to state they believe Trinity will finish up with Impact at their Orlando tapings.

H/T Ringside News

Naomi could appear at the Rumble, even if she is still signed with TNA. TNA Wrestling and the WWE could work out a deal for Naomi to appear at the Rumble, much as it did when TNA Knockouts Champion Mickie James appeared at the 2022 Royal Rumble.

Sean Waltman (aka X-Pac): Sean Waltman's name has come up over the last few years as a surprise entrant but a recent report from PWInsider suggests this year could be his year. Last week, PWInsider reported:

The word making the rounds at the WWE Performance Center today is that WWE Hall of Famer Sean “X-Pac” Waltman will be down at the facility this week.

H/T Ringside News

An X-Pac return would likely pop the crowd. Despite Internet smarks creating the term "X-Pac heat" (used to refer to wrestlers who make fans want to change the channel), the two-time WWE Hall of Famer remains a popular figure. At 51, it's even possible that X-Pac could return for a short program.

Liv Morgan: Another name is Liv Morgan. The popular Superstar has been out of action since she injured her shoulder last summer. However, Ringside News' Felix Upton is reporting:

Liv Morgan is also in the mix, with talks of her comeback from injury circulating. It was reported that word started in November 2023 indicating that Liv was anticipated to return soon from a shoulder injury.

H/T Ringside News

If Liv does return, fans will be intrigued to see how she fares in the Rumble. Last year Liv emerged as a runner-up to Rhea Ripley and might have won except she was inadvertently sprayed in the face with poison mist by Asuka (who was aiming at Ripley).
